-
Notifications
You must be signed in to change notification settings - Fork 2
Infrastructure
Michael "Z" Goddard edited this page Feb 21, 2014
·
1 revision
-
socket.io
-
cloak
-
express
-
backbone.js
-
grunt
-
AMD
-
jade
- mocha with tdd interface
- chai with assert interface
- testem
-
grunt- test
- shell
NODE_ENV=development node src
Launch the root server for convenience.
-
grunt test- lint
- testem ci
-
grunt prod- test
- compile to
/dist
The server uses the NODE_ENV environment variable idiom.
-
NODE_ENV=development node srcinstructs the server to run in development mode. -
NODE_ENV=production node srcinstructs the server to run in production mode.
-
srcFolder containing all source: Javascript, CSS superset, and templates.-
activitiesFolder containing subfolders for activities.-
cacaoFolder containing source related to only cacao.-
clientFolder containing client side source.-
stylesCSS superset source for cacao. -
templatesJade files for cacao. -
*.jsJavascript files for cacao. -
main.jsThe client-side main js file.
-
-
serverFolder containing server side source. -
index.jsconvenience script for cacao server.
-
-
-
clientClient side generic code. -
serverServer side generic code. -
index.jsconvenience script for server.
-
Gruntfile.jspackage.json
